How I Work — And Why It's Different

Buying a home is one of the biggest decisions of your life--and most people don't consider their health when searching for a home. I do things differently. I work with only a few clients at a time and treat each transaction like it's my own family moving into a home. I bring my A-Game, every time, because the stakes are high!

The Deep Dive
We start with a brief intake call (book on my Calendly), and then meet for coffee for a thorough health/home consultation. We discuss health history, family goals, budget, location and more! These two conversations set the stage for our search.

Escrow Due Diligence
The secret sauce! We do MANY inspections during Escrow so you can understand the true condition of your home. It also gives me a ton of negotiating leverage during our request for repairs period.

We start with a thorough intake meeting. I get your history, and go through your goals for your new home. From there, we hone in on price and location, and do showings. The magic happens during Escrow, when we do a substantial amount of diligence to ensure you are purchasing a home that makes sense health-wise!

I bring a moisture meter with me to showings, and I am a canary myself so can normally tell quickly if the home has a big mold problem. However, the true magic happens during Escrow. I recommend an ERMI, mold dog, and mold inspection so we thoroughly understand what is going on with the home. It is more money upfront, but brings so much knowledge and peace of mind long term.

This depends substantially on what you’re looking for, as well as whether you have a budget for remediation, as well as how sensitive you are. For some clients, we nail it fast (1-2 weeks). For others, we have to kiss a lot of frogs. We go through all of this in our thorough intake meeting.

There are many factors! We look at whether you feel at home in the community, assess for mold, assess for EMFs, evaluate the outdoor environment, discuss building science and healthy building materials, and more! The highest priorities for a healthy home are different for each and every client.
